Frequently Asked Questions about South Capitol
What type of rentals are currently available in South Capitol?
There are currently 124 Apartments for Rent in South Capitol, WA with pricing that ranges from $1,199 to $5,089. There are also 16 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in South Capitol ranging from $1,190 to $3,975.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in South Capitol?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in South Capitol ranges from $1,190 to $3,975 with an average monthly rent of $2,286.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in South Capitol?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in South Capitol range from $1,646 to $3,770,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,899 to $3,195.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,650 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,895.
